India won in an iconic test match against England today. The second test series being held in Andhra Pradesh (Visakhapatnam) for the first time, saw India win its 15th consecutive test match.
India sealed its victory when it scored 158 in 97.3 on its final day. India beat England by 246 runs while England lost their last eight wickets on just 66 runs on the last day today, losing 5 in the morning and three more after lunch. Kohli was named ‘Man of the Match’ after scoring 167 and 81.
Indian spinners shined well today, with even captain Virat Kohli heaping praises. Debutant Jayant Yadav who took three wickets was praised by Kohli, “It’s always priceless those contributions and it speaks volumes of his character. For a young guy to come in and tell his captain the field he wants, the line and length he would bowl, it shows he knows what he is doing. I’m really happy for him. ” Yadav had displayed good batting talent too previously. Ravichandran Ashwin and Ravindra Jadeja also deserve credit for their part in India’s win.
Speaking about playing in Vizag, he said, “It’s been a lucky ground for me and it remains a special ground, similar feel I get to Adelaide. You want to play exciting cricket because so many people come to watch. They help you through tough situations .”
The first test in Rajkot was a draw and the third starts in Mohali on November 26.
